Construction Closeout Package Fundamentals

The construction closeout process serves as the bridge between project completion and client satisfaction. It's during this phase that all loose ends get tied together, documentation gets compiled, and the project officially transitions from construction to operation.

Core Components Every Closeout Package Must Include

Every comprehensive closeout package starts with five essential elements that can't be overlooked. As-built drawings represent the most critical component, capturing every modification made during construction. These aren't simply updated blueprints; they're precise records showing exactly what was built, where utilities run, and how systems connect.

Operation and maintenance manuals follow closely behind in importance. These documents become the owner's roadmap for keeping their facility running smoothly. Without them, even minor maintenance tasks can become expensive service calls.

Warranty documentation protects everyone involved by clearly defining what's covered, for how long, and under what conditions. This paperwork often determines whether a future repair comes out of the owner's pocket or remains the contractor's responsibility.

Essential Documentation Categories for Construction Project Closeout

Successful project handovers depend on the methodical organization of documentation into logical categories. This systematic approach prevents important items from getting overlooked during the rush to complete.

Compliance and Regulatory Documentation

Building permits and code compliance certificates form the legal foundation of every project. These documents prove that construction met all applicable standards and regulations. Without them, owners can face serious legal issues down the road.

Environmental impact assessments document how the project affected its surroundings. Safety inspection reports provide evidence that the facility meets all workplace safety requirements. Accessibility compliance verification ensures the building serves all users appropriately.

These documents often require specific formatting or digital signatures, making early preparation essential for meeting deadlines.

Financial and Administrative Records

Final cost accounting and change order documentation tell the complete financial story of the project. This category directly impacts when contractors receive their final payment, since clients need clear records of all expenses and modifications.

Lien waivers and payment certifications protect all parties from future financial disputes. Insurance certificates and bonding documentation demonstrate that proper coverage remained in place throughout construction.

Subcontractor closeout packages deserve special attention, as incomplete sub-tier documentation frequently delays overall project completion.

Technical Documentation and Performance Data

Equipment commissioning reports verify that all systems operate as designed. These documents become invaluable references when future modifications or repairs are needed.

Energy performance verification increasingly matters as sustainability requirements tighten. 

System integration testing results prove that different building systems work together properly. Cybersecurity assessments for smart building systems address growing concerns about digital vulnerabilities.

Your Closeout Package Questions Answered

What is a closeout item?

A closeout item refers to any remaining task, document, or deliverable that must be completed before a construction project can be officially considered finished and handed over to the owner.

What three things are usually included in a closeout report?

Closeout reports typically include project performance evaluation against original goals, final cost accounting with all change orders documented, and lessons learned for future project improvement.

How long should the construction closeout process take?

Timelines vary significantly by project size and complexity, but typical commercial projects require 30-90 days for complete closeout, while larger projects may extend several months or longer.

Who is responsible for collecting closeout documentation?

The general contractor typically coordinates overall closeout package assembly, but individual subcontractors, suppliers, and design professionals contribute specific documentation elements according to contract requirements.
